>> Speaking of this, are there overriding reasons to keep supporting 2.4.x?
>
>
>       Maybe we should take a survey as to what people are using. For 
> Xenserver plugins, I have to code to 2.4, since they use a CentOS version 
> that still uses Python 2.4, and will for some time.
>
>       I'd love to move to at least 2.6, but if there isn't any compelling 
> benefit, I prefer to support as many versions as possible. The addition of 
> decorators and Decimal made the jump from 2.3 to 2.4 huge; the addition of a 
> ternary if statement is relatively minor.

Agree. The ternary statement comes in handy in report writer expressions, but 
isn't 
absolutely essential, and that's a minor part of dabo anyway.
